So i had the car on the rollers today at EcoTune in Hillington (Glasgow) who are renowned for being brutally honest. I was surprised that the car managed to do better than I expected and the best of 3 runs peaked a 153.5bhp, 245 ft/lbs torque :D Not bad for a stage one REVO map and a panel filter!
